From d0c4e8cc25dc3bfed1659c35fb59b2f0418ba1d5 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: =?UTF-8?q?Volker=20R=C3=BCmelin?= Date: Thu, 19 Dec 2019 21:34:05 +0100 Subject: [PATCH 2/8] audio: fix integer overflow MIME-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ain; charset=UTF-8 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it Tell the compiler to do a 32bit * 32bit -> 64bit multiplication because period_ticks is a 64bit variable. The overflow occurs for audio timer periods larger than 4294967us.
